What is Double Glazing?
Double glazing is a type of insulation that involves 2 panes of glass separated by a space, typically filled with air or inert gas. This setup serves a main purpose: to decrease heat transfer between the exterior and interior of a structure. As a result, double-glazed windows assist retain heat throughout winter and keep spaces cooler throughout summer.

Typical Double Glazing Materials
1. Glass Types
The efficiency of double glazing is largely affected by the kind of glass utilized. Below are the typical kinds of glass utilized in double glazing:
Glass Type | Description | Advantages | Downsides |
---|---|---|---|
Float Glass | Basic glass, usually utilized in standard applications. | Affordable | Less insulation compared to Low-E glass. |
Low-Emissivity (Low-E) | Glass covered with a thin metallic layer to show heat. | Exceptional insulation, preserves natural light. | Higher initial expense. |
Tempered Glass | Heat-treated glass that is more powerful and safer. | More resilient, resistant to impact. | Can be more pricey due to processing. |
Laminated Glass | Glass layers bonded with a plastic interlayer. | Deals security and UV security. | Heavier and more expensive choices. |
2. Spacer Bars
Spacer bars are the products that separate the 2 panes of glass in a double-glazed system. Different products can be used for this function:
Spacer Bar Material | Description | Benefits | Drawbacks |
---|---|---|---|
Aluminium | Lightweight and rigid but conductive. | Long lasting and affordable. | Can result in condensation due to heat transfer. |
PVC-U | A plastic choice, less conductive compared to aluminum. | Excellent thermal performance. | May not be as long lasting as aluminum. |
Warm Edge Technology | Typically includes a composite material. | Lowers thermal bridging, enhancing effectiveness. | Usually more pricey. |
3. Gas Fills
The gap in between the panes of glass can be filled with air or specific gases to boost insulation.
Gas Type | Description | Benefits | Downsides |
---|---|---|---|
Air | Regular air with no special properties. | Cost-effective and enough for lots of applications. | Lower insulation than gas-filled systems. |
Argon | Inert gas that is denser than air. | Excellent thermal insulation. | More costly than air but frequently justified. |
Krypton | Heavier and more efficient than argon. | Best insulation of the gas choices. | Much higher expense and requires specialized methods. |
Aspects Influencing the Choice of Double Glazing Materials
When choosing materials for double glazing, numerous elements must be taken into account:
- Climate: The local climate has a considerable influence on energy effectiveness, dictating the need for particular glass types or gas fills.
- Budget plan: Initial expenses might exceed long-term advantages. House owners ought to stabilize in advance expenditures with possible cost savings.
- Aesthetic Preference: Different frames and glass types provide a series of visual styles that need to match the architecture of the home.
- Building Regulations: Local structure codes might dictate specific products, demanding adherence to these guidelines.
Upkeep of Double Glazed Units
Beyond the setup of double glazing units, routine maintenance is important for durability and effectiveness. Here are a few maintenance ideas:
- Regular Cleaning: Use proper cleaners for both glass and frames to prevent accumulation of dirt and gunk.
- Inspect Seals: Periodically check window seals for damage or wear, as compromised seals can dramatically lower insulation effectiveness.
- Condensation Control: Monitor for condensation between panes, which might suggest seal failure and necessitate repair.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: How long do double-glazed windows last?
A: Typically, double-glazed windows can last anywhere from 20 to 35 years, depending on the quality of materials and installation.
Q: Can I replace simply one pane of a double-glazed system?
A: It is generally advised to replace the whole double-glazed unit for optimum performance, as changing just one pane can result in mismatching insulation residential or commercial properties.
Q: Are double-glazed systems more costly than single glazing?
A: Yes, double-glazed systems typically have a higher upfront expense due to advanced materials and construction, but they typically spend for themselves through energy cost savings.
Q: Will double glazing decrease noise contamination?

A: Yes, double-glazing effectively decreases outside sound, making your living environment more tranquil.
